Bulls say

Equitable Holdings Inc. has demonstrated robust financial performance, reflected in a 35% earnings increase in its Group Retirement segment, supported by higher fee-based revenue and an improved net interest margin. The company anticipates generating $1.6-$1.7 billion in cash for 2025, marking a significant increase from the previous year, alongside a 12% rise in account values to $40.7 billion primarily due to favorable market conditions. Additionally, the Asset Management segment reported a 41% increase in operating earnings, benefiting from higher average assets under management (AUM) and performance fees, further solidifying a positive outlook for the company's financial trajectory.

Bears say

Equitable Holdings Inc. experienced a modest decrease in account values, down 2% year-over-year due to market performance and ongoing outflows, indicating a potential challenge in maintaining asset levels. The company's operating earnings revealed a significant decline, reducing from $68 million to $43 million in the fourth quarter, alongside a slight drop in the operating return on assets, suggesting diminishing profitability. Continued unfavorable mortality trends and a lack of effective strategies to enhance free cash flow generation introduce further risks that could hinder the company's earnings growth, reinforcing a negative outlook on the stock.
